PharmaCARE (We CARE about YOUR health®) is one of the
world’s most successful pharmaceutical companies, enjoying a
reputation as a caring, ethical and well-run company that produces
high-quality products that save millions of lives and enhance the
quality of life for millions of others. The company offers free and
discounted drugs to low-income consumers, has a foundation that sponsors
healthcare educational programs and scholarships, and its CEO serves on
the PhRMA board. PharmaCARE recently launched a new initiative, We CARE
about YOUR world®, pledging its commitment to the environment through
recycling, packaging changes and other green initiatives, despite the
fact that the company’s lobbying efforts and PAC have successfully
defeated environmental laws and regulations, including extension of the
Superfund tax, which was created by Comprehensive Environmental
Response, Compensation, and Liability Act (CERCLA).

Based in New
Jersey, PharmaCARE maintains a large manufacturing facility in the
African nation of Colberia, where the company has found several
“healers” eager to freely share information about indigenous cures
and an abundance of Colberians willing to work for $1.00 a day,
harvesting plants by walking five (5) miles into and out of the jungle
carrying baskets that, when full, weigh up to fifty (50) pounds. Due to
the low standard of living in Colberia, much of the population lives in
primitive huts with no electricity or running water. PharmaCARE’s
executives, however, live in a luxury compound, complete with a swimming
pool, tennis courts, and a golf course. PharmaCARE’s extensive
activities in Colberia have destroyed habitat and endangered native
species.
